Nathaniel King is an author and poet from Cornwall, UK. His debut poetry pamphlet, Ghost Clinic, was published with Broken Sleep Books in 2023, and received an Eric Gregory Award by the Society of Authors in 2024.

He has been widely published in UK and international magazines, and is currently completing a creative-critical PhD at Royal Holloway, researching landscape poetics and W.S Graham’s relationship to St Ives Modernist painting. 

He has experience facilitating creative writing workshops for adults and young people, as well as teaching secondary and further education, at institutions such as The University of Cambridge and Royal Holloway, University of London. He currently teaches and works as a First Story poet-in-residence, and lives in Cambridgeshire in a house on the river with his cat, Parsnip.
